First published in poems 1831, to helen is full of mythological imagery and consists of three quintains in iambic tetrameter with random rhyme patterns. Edgar allan poes stature as a major figure in world literature is primarily based on his ingenious and profound short stories, poems, and critical theories, which established a highly influential rationale for the short form in both poetry and fiction. The poem employs contrast between the chaos of the outside world and the consistency of helen s beauty by describing the speaker on desperate seas being brought home by hyacinth hair and naiad airs.
